Output 16529371505345543c4e248ed957ea0ddbe59be33194a0c7f5c05da8463559a0:2

value
24660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55fe0555a1f6631a691ebc1bdc69cc1b14ac01f2 OP_EQUAL
address
39XhfXVf3QQxRztykPqiigAsCaLuWkvjLu
transaction
16529371505345543c4e248ed957ea0ddbe59be33194a0c7f5c05da8463559a0
spent
true